/ Forside / Teknologi / Operativsystemer / Linux /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Linux
#NavnPoint
o.v.n. 11177
peque 7911
dk 4814
e.c 2359
Uranus 1334
emesen 1334
stone47 1307
linuxrules 1214
Octon 1100
10  BjarneD 875
cat > clipboard
Fra : Stig Sørensen


Dato : 11-02-05 19:49

Hejsa.

Kan man cat'e noget direkte til clipboard?
Altså, den clipboard der gemmer på hvad man sidst har markeret med musen?

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
for et par minutter siden. Her åbnede jeg xterm og skrev :

$ cat /etc/apt/sources.list

Herefter gjorde jeg xterm vinduet så stort så man kunne se hele
indholdet samtidigt. Jeg markede så alt indholdet, førte musen over i
formen på hjemmesiden og pastede indholdet direkte ind.

Jeg tænkte på, der må da være en nemmere måde - hvad hvis min
sources.list var 27 sider lang?

Mvh
Stig Sørensen

 
 
Jesper Krogh (11-02-2005)
Kommentar
Fra : Jesper Krogh


Dato : 11-02-05 20:24

I dk.edb.system.unix, skrev Stig Sørensen:
>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
> for et par minutter siden. Her åbnede jeg xterm og skrev :
>
> $ cat /etc/apt/sources.list

Du skal skrive:
$ cat - > /etc/apt/sources.list

og slutte af med crtl+d

Så ja, det kan du.


--
../Jesper Krogh, jesper@krogh.cc, Jabber ID: jesper@jabbernet.dk
Danmark har fået sit eget Mozillaforum:
http://forum.mozilladanmark.dk/ eller nntp://news.sslug.dk/mozilladanmark.*


Kent Friis (11-02-2005)
Kommentar
Fra : Kent Friis


Dato : 11-02-05 20:26

Den Fri, 11 Feb 2005 19:23:46 +0000 (UTC) skrev Jesper Krogh:
> I dk.edb.system.unix, skrev Stig Sørensen:
>>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
>> for et par minutter siden. Her åbnede jeg xterm og skrev :
>>
>> $ cat /etc/apt/sources.list
>
> Du skal skrive:
> $ cat - > /etc/apt/sources.list
>
> og slutte af med crtl+d

NEJ!!!! Stig, lad være med at gøre det, den kommando overskriver din
sources.list.

Og iøvrigt er "-" overflødigt i den kommando, hvis endelig man vil
overskrive filen.

Mvh
Kent
--
Help test this great MMORPG game - http://www.eternal-lands.com/

Jesper Krogh (11-02-2005)
Kommentar
Fra : Jesper Krogh


Dato : 11-02-05 20:28

I dk.edb.system.unix, skrev Kent Friis:
> Den Fri, 11 Feb 2005 19:23:46 +0000 (UTC) skrev Jesper Krogh:
> > I dk.edb.system.unix, skrev Stig Sørensen:
> >>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
> >> for et par minutter siden. Her åbnede jeg xterm og skrev :
> >>
> >> $ cat /etc/apt/sources.list
> >
> > Du skal skrive:
> > $ cat - > /etc/apt/sources.list
> >
> > og slutte af med crtl+d
>
> NEJ!!!! Stig, lad være med at gøre det, den kommando overskriver din
> sources.list.
>
> Og iøvrigt er "-" overflødigt i den kommando, hvis endelig man vil
> overskrive filen.

Hmm, jeg må vist hellers sign'e af for i aften. Jeg fik jo lige svaret
på det modsatte spørgsmål.. (hvordan man paster ind i en fil), i stedet.

Det er også godt at det er weekend..

Jesper

--
../Jesper Krogh, jesper@krogh.cc, Jabber ID: jesper@jabbernet.dk
Danmark har fået sit eget Mozillaforum:
http://forum.mozilladanmark.dk/ eller nntp://news.sslug.dk/mozilladanmark.*


Jørn Hundebøll (11-02-2005)
Kommentar
Fra : Jørn Hundebøll


Dato : 11-02-05 20:09

Stig Sørensen wrote:
> Hejsa.
>
> Kan man cat'e noget direkte til clipboard?
> Altså, den clipboard der gemmer på hvad man sidst har markeret med musen?
>
>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
> for et par minutter siden. Her åbnede jeg xterm og skrev :
>
> $ cat /etc/apt/sources.list

Jeg ved ikke om der findes en direkte løsning fra en xterm til
clipboard, men ellers plejer jeg bare at åbne filen i Firefox

/bin/sti_til_firefox /home/bruger/fil

og <CTRL>a for select-all også kan du copy og paste alt hvad du ønsker.



Jørn

Stig Sørensen (11-02-2005)
Kommentar
Fra : Stig Sørensen


Dato : 11-02-05 21:47

On Fri, 11 Feb 2005 20:09:17 +0100, Jørn Hundebøll wrote:

> Stig Sørensen wrote:
>> Hejsa.
>>
>> Kan man cat'e noget direkte til clipboard?
>> Altså, den clipboard der gemmer på hvad man sidst har markeret med musen?
>>
>>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
>> for et par minutter siden. Her åbnede jeg xterm og skrev :
>>
>> $ cat /etc/apt/sources.list
>
> Jeg ved ikke om der findes en direkte løsning fra en xterm til
> clipboard, men ellers plejer jeg bare at åbne filen i Firefox
>
> /bin/sti_til_firefox /home/bruger/fil
>
> og <CTRL>a for select-all også kan du copy og paste alt hvad du ønsker.

Det var selvfølgelig også en mulighed. Istedetfor ovenstående løsning
ville jeg nok selv bare bruge Scite (editor).

Men hvis nogen skulle vide om det kan lade sig gøre, så skal man da
være velkommen at skrive :)

Søren A Christensen (12-02-2005)
Kommentar
Fra : Søren A Christensen


Dato : 12-02-05 12:07

For mig at se er I igang med at finde den korrekte løsning til det
forkerte problem .... hvorfor overhovedet trække data over clip-boardet ?

Hvis behovet er at vise en opdateret sources.list på web-siden er der 2
mere korrekte metoder:
1) Hvis listningen skal være 100% up2date, lave et cgi-script (eller
andet fancy dynamisk web-side) der viser den opdaterede liste når det
bliver kaldt.

2) Lave et script der kører fra cron og opdaterer html filen rn gang i
døgnet, hver time eller hvad der nu er behov for.

Og endelig, hvis man vil holde fast i den manuelle "klippe-klistre model":

cat /etc/apt/sources.list > minfil.html
editer minfil.html og indsæt korrekt html header og body tags før og
efter sourses listningen, med en <PRE> lige før, og </PRE> lige efter.

Og ... Nej, jeg svarer ikke senere på hvordan du skriver et (cgi-)
script. Det må du selv læse dig frem til ... lidt sjov skal du også have.

Mvh Søren

Stig Sørensen wrote:
> Hejsa.
>
> Kan man cat'e noget direkte til clipboard?
> Altså, den clipboard der gemmer på hvad man sidst har markeret med musen?
>
> Feks, havde jeg brug for at vise hele min sources.list på en hjemmeside
> for et par minutter siden. Her åbnede jeg xterm og skrev :
>
> $ cat /etc/apt/sources.list
>
> Herefter gjorde jeg xterm vinduet så stort så man kunne se hele
> indholdet samtidigt. Jeg markede så alt indholdet, førte musen over i
> formen på hjemmesiden og pastede indholdet direkte ind.
>
> Jeg tænkte på, der må da være en nemmere måde - hvad hvis min
> sources.list var 27 sider lang?
>
> Mvh
> Stig Sørensen

Stig Sørensen (12-02-2005)
Kommentar
Fra : Stig Sørensen


Dato : 12-02-05 12:34

On Sat, 12 Feb 2005 12:06:32 +0100, Søren A Christensen wrote:

> For mig at se er I igang med at finde den korrekte løsning til det
> forkerte problem .... hvorfor overhovedet trække data over clip-boardet ?

Ked af at sige det, men det er desværre dig der har læst lidt forkert.


> Hvis behovet er at vise en opdateret sources.list på web-siden er der 2
> mere korrekte metoder:

Det er ikke behovet. Det er ikke _min_ hjemmeside, jeg havde blot behov
for at vise min sources.list på et forum. (Sources.list er jo blot et
eksempel, det kunne have været en log fil også)


Feks, hvis jeg havde brug for at vise en log fil her, i denne tråd, og
logfilen var 27 sider lang, så ville det være rart hvis man kunne gøre
noget i stil med:

$ cat /sti/til/logfil > clipboard
(Åbne Pan, svar på tråden og trykke på midterste knap på musen, så
pastes logfil)

Jeg ved ikke om det er windows manageren der står for det, men sådan
fungere det i hvert fald hos mig. Hvis jeg blot markere noget tekst så er
det automatisk kopiere og kan nemt pastes med et klik på midterste
museknap (Min mus har kun 2 knapper, men scroll'en fungere også som en
knap)

Mvh
Stig Sørensen

Niels Baggesen (12-02-2005)
Kommentar
Fra : Niels Baggesen


Dato : 12-02-05 13:35

Stig Sørensen <no@mail.nospam> wrote:
> $ cat /sti/til/logfil > clipboard
> (Åbne Pan, svar på tråden og trykke på midterste knap på musen, så
> pastes logfil)

Personligt ville jeg i en sådan situation skifte til en "rigtig" editor
og sige :r (eller M-x insert-file, alt efter humøret)

/Niels

--
Niels Baggesen -- @home -- Århus -- Denmark -- niels@baggesen.net
The purpose of computing is insight, not numbers -- R W Hamming

Ivar Madsen (12-02-2005)
Kommentar
Fra : Ivar Madsen


Dato : 12-02-05 14:14

Stig Sørensen wrote:

> Feks, hvis jeg havde brug for at vise en log fil her, i denne tråd, og
> logfilen var 27 sider lang, så ville det være rart hvis man kunne gøre
> noget i stil med:

Hvis det var mig, og jeg ikke kunne korte af i loggen, så ville jeg ikke
gøre sådan, så ville jeg få gang i min web server igen*) og så ligge den
der, mere end 30-40 linier, synes jeg ikke om at copiere ind i et indlæg.
27 sider vil også få flere newsservere til at droppe indlægget,,,

OK, det var kun en eksempel på et eller andet der er for stort til at skrive
af, men aligevel,,,

*) Rent dovenskab som gør at jeg ikke har fået sat den op efter sidste
reinstall af maskinen,,,

--
Med venlig hilsen

Ivar Madsen

Stig Sørensen (12-02-2005)
Kommentar
Fra : Stig Sørensen


Dato : 12-02-05 14:34

On Sat, 12 Feb 2005 14:14:05 +0100, Ivar Madsen wrote:

> Stig Sørensen wrote:
>
>> Feks, hvis jeg havde brug for at vise en log fil her, i denne tråd, og
>> logfilen var 27 sider lang, så ville det være rart hvis man kunne gøre
>> noget i stil med:
>
> Hvis det var mig, og jeg ikke kunne korte af i loggen, så ville jeg ikke
> gøre sådan, så ville jeg få gang i min web server igen*) og så ligge den
> der, mere end 30-40 linier, synes jeg ikke om at copiere ind i et indlæg.
> 27 sider vil også få flere newsservere til at droppe indlægget,,,

Helt enig. Men nu tog jeg tallet 27 kun for at overdrive i håb om bedre
forståelse :)

Desuden var det også blot et eksempel.

> OK, det var kun en eksempel på et eller andet der er for stort til at
> skrive af, men aligevel,,,
>
> *) Rent dovenskab som gør at jeg ikke har fået sat den op efter sidste
> reinstall af maskinen,,,

Kan du så komme igang! :)

Henrik Farre (12-02-2005)
Kommentar
Fra : Henrik Farre


Dato : 12-02-05 12:36

fre, 11 02 2005 kl. 19:49 +0100, skrev Stig Sørensen:

> Herefter gjorde jeg xterm vinduet så stort så man kunne se hele
> indholdet samtidigt. Jeg markede så alt indholdet, førte musen over i
> formen på hjemmesiden og pastede indholdet direkte ind.
>
> Jeg tænkte på, der må da være en nemmere måde - hvad hvis min
> sources.list var 27 sider lang?

http://people.debian.org/~kims/xclip/
http://www.vergenet.net/~conrad/software/xsel/
http://xcut.sourceforge.net/

--
Mvh. / Kind regards
Henrik Farre - http://www.rockhopper.dk

Get Firefox! - http://www.spreadfirefox.com/?q=affiliates&id=31865&t=1


Stig Sørensen (12-02-2005)
Kommentar
Fra : Stig Sørensen


Dato : 12-02-05 14:01

On Sat, 12 Feb 2005 12:36:28 +0100, Henrik Farre wrote:

> fre, 11 02 2005 kl. 19:49 +0100, skrev Stig Sørensen:
>
>> Herefter gjorde jeg xterm vinduet så stort så man kunne se hele
>> indholdet samtidigt. Jeg markede så alt indholdet, førte musen over i
>> formen på hjemmesiden og pastede indholdet direkte ind.
>>
>> Jeg tænkte på, der må da være en nemmere måde - hvad hvis min
>> sources.list var 27 sider lang?
>
> http://people.debian.org/~kims/xclip/
> http://www.vergenet.net/~conrad/software/xsel/
> http://xcut.sourceforge.net/

Hej Henrik!
Tak for hjælpen, Xclip gør jeg præcis hvad jeg har brug for.

$ xclip /etc/apt/sources.list


Mvh
Stig Sørensen

Søg
Reklame
Statistik
Spørgsmål : 177552
Tips : 31968
Nyheder : 719565
Indlæg : 6408847
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ste